Why optimize your email registration forms?
An email sign-up form is often a prospect’s first interaction with your brand. If it’s well-designed, concise, and offers value, it will entice visitors to subscribe. However, if the form is too long, poorly placed, or doesn’t offer a clear incentive, people are likely to skip it. Optimizing your sign-up form is about maximizing your conversion rates by removing barriers and increasing the appeal of signing up. Here are best practices to help you optimize your email sign-up forms for higher conversions.

1. Keep the form simple and short
One of the biggest mistakes businesses make is asking for too much information up front. The more fields you ask for, the less likely visitors are to fill out the form. To maximize conversions, keep your form simple—just ask for a name and email address.

Tips that help:
Limit required fields : Stick to basic information like name and email address. You can always request more details later in the customer journey.
Use autofill features : Enable autofill options that make it easier for users to fill out the form without much effort.
Mobile Optimization : Make sure your form is responsive and mobile-friendly, as a significant number of users will register on their phones.
The simpler your form is, the more likely visitors are to fill it out, which will lead to the growth of your email list.

2. Use a strong call to action (CTA)
A call to action (CTA) is a button that encourages visitors to take the next step and submit their information. To maximize conversion rates, your CTA needs to stand out, both visually and in terms of message.

Tips that help:
Use action-oriented language : Instead of a generic “Submit,” use more compelling text like “Join Now,” “Get a Free Guide,” or “Sign Up and Save.”
Make it visually prominent : Make sure the CTA button contrasts with the rest of the form and page to draw attention. It should be easily recognizable, no matter where it is placed.
Test CTA placement : A/B test different call-to-action button placements and styles to see which one drives higher conversions. Consider adding a call-to-action above the edge for instant visibility.
A compelling call to action will tell your audience exactly what they'll get and prompt immediate action, increasing your chances of converting visitors into subscribers .

3. Offer a clear incentive
Visitors are more likely to share their email address if there is a clear benefit to them. Offering a value exchange – such as a discount code, exclusive content, or free resource – can significantly increase signups.
